This DIY 3D printer kit prints objects of maximum 20 x 20 x 20 cm by using different kinds of filament with a diameter of 3 mm. The K8200 is compatible with all free RepRap software and firmware and is the ideal 3D printer for advanced makers.
Because the printer is made out of aluminium profiles it is easy to assemble and it also leaves room for the user to freely alter the machine and modify it to their liking. Plus, the print bed is heated so your printed parts will come off easily too!

Specifications
linear ball bearings: 8 and 10 mm (0.314" and 0.393")
technology: FFF (Fused Filament Fabrication) for PLA and ABS
power supply: 15 Vdc / 6,6A max.
connection: FTDI USB 2.0 to Serial
dimensions of printable area: 20 x 20 x 20cm / 7.87 x 7.87 x 7.87"
typical printing speed: 120 mm/s
heated bed: max. temperature 60°C
maximum print speed: 150 to 300 mm/s (depending on the object to be printed)
extrusion nozzle: 0.5 mm
extrusion thermistor: NTC 100K
extruded aluminum profiles: 27.5 mm / 1.08" wide
movement: 4 NEMA 17 stepper motors
resolution:
nominal mechanical resolution:
X and Y: 0.015 mm / 590.55 µin (smallest step the printing plate can move in the X and Y direction)
Z: 0.781 µm / 30.74 µin(smallest step the printing plate can move in the Z direction)
